Title: Empowering Girls through Project Tag: Pad A Girl

Introduction:

Earlier today, I had the privilege to lead a team of passionate Rotaractors from Rotaract Zone M, D9110, on a transformative project called Tag Pad A Girl. Our primary goal was to distribute 500 sanitary pads among the female students of Oto-Awori Junior Grammar School. Throughout the duration of the project, we witnessed firsthand the positive impact it had on the lives of these girls. Not only did it ensure their dignity, but it also empowered them to pursue their education without any interruptions.

Empowering Girls for a Brighter Future:

One of the critical barriers that hinder the education of girls in many communities is the lack of access to menstrual hygiene products. The stigma associated with menstruation often leads to girls missing school, affecting their academic performance and overall personal growth. Realizing this pressing issue, our team set out to break these barriers and provide a sustainable solution.
